How much does lawn care cost in Wombwell?
If you sign up for a monthly weed and feed lawn treatment package, the average monthly cost is around £14. Meanwhile, the cost of a one-off treatment is £45.
Need help with lawn mowing, too? The average cost of residential lawn mowing is around £30 per hour.
What do lawn care services include?
Lawn care services can cover weed control, aeration, scarification, feeding, and seasonal treatments to keep your grass strong and green. Mowing and edging are also options, but this will be an additional cost.
How often should I book lawn care in Wombwell?
Most lawn care services will offer a monthly or annual service package. This usually involves multiple visits over the different seasons to target the specific needs of your lawn – whether it's weed and moss control or soil conditioning.
Can lawn care services improve patchy or damaged grass?
Yes, lawn care services can improve patchy and damaged grass. Weed and feed lawn treatments, such as reseeding, scarification, and fertilisation, can help restore bare patches and improve overall lawn health. Investing in a sprinkler can improve the health of your lawn, too.
Do I need regular lawn care or just one-off visits?
Whether or not your garden needs regular lawn care or just a one-off visit depends on your goals. Some homeowners prefer a one-off tidy-up to keep on top of weeds and moss. However, if you want your lawn to remain in peak condition year-round, consider opting for a monthly plan.
